Latest Patents

Asanuma holds a patent for "Photographic polyolefin coated paper bases with ionomer layer." This invention involves a base for photographic sensitive material that comprises a polyolefin coated paper. The improvement includes a layer of an ionomer of an α-olefin and an α,β-ethylenically unsaturated carboxylic acid situated between the surface of the paper and the polyolefin coating. This innovation enhances the quality and durability of photographic materials.
